6 Helpful Tips for Selecting a Conservatories Designer

A conservatory is a compelling approach to extend a home without forking out for a blocks and mortar extension and has additionally been demonstrated to add value to your home.
Nonetheless, with such a large number of sizes, shapes, and suppliers out there, picking the right conservatory for your home can be a difficult decision. However, a conservatories designer can help you to take a right decision.

But, again, it is tricky to choose a conservatories designer.

Let’s see, how you can select a conservatories designer.

Tips for Selecting a Conservatories Designer
A conservatories designer is in charge of making and executing tasteful design plans for a conservatory. Their duties depend on the project, and may incorporate things like selecting a color plan, looking for furniture and conservatory decor objects, advising on fixtures and so on.
If you are interested on employing a conservatories designer, then it is important that you find a designer who is most appropriate to you and your needs.

Tip 1: Figure Out Your Personal Style
Picking a conservatories designer is simpler when you recognize what sort of impact you need to fulfill through your decor. You have to disclose it to your designer. Take notes, make a list of what you like and what you do not care for. You can also collect some pictures of conservatory designs you like and can show your designer.

Tip 2: Develop a Financial Plan
Before you meet with a conservatories designer, you ought to know precisely what you need to fulfill, in what spaces, and the amount you can spend. You will need to pick a conservatories designer who can work with your financial plan.
You are the one who knows the amount of cash you can spend on a venture and you have to precisely impart that number to the conservatories designer so he or she can settle on the right decisions and recommendations. Given how many options a conservatories designer can explore, it is imperative to have few guidelines.

Tip 4: See the Portfolios and Management Style
Each conservatories designer has a portfolio of past activities, and looking through the work of a designer will give you a smart thought of that designer's versatility and personal style.
Ask how the designer arranges assignments, for example, how regularly they will check in with you, what sort of work they would contract out, and what sort of balances system they have set up to guarantee the work you enlisted them to do is finished in a satisfactory way.

Tip 5: Find out the Work Ethic
It is essential to see whether the conservatories designer is action oriented or self-motivated, or if the customer needed to incite the conservatories designer to remain focused. Furthermore, a great designer should be on time, and ought to make it a point to be completely knowledgeable about the business.

Tip 6: Check References
The most ideal approach to gauge the nature of a conservatories designer is to ask individuals who have utilized the services of the designer. Any trustworthy expert will have the capacity to give you a contacts sheet of certain references. Call each reference.
